What Is A2E AI?
A2E is an aggregator platform that gives you access to multiple leading AI video models in one place, including Kling, Wan, Seedance, HappyHorse, Veo, and Sora 2. Unlike Runway or Pika (which each bet on a single proprietary model), A2E's business model is to bundle competing models under one roof and let you switch between them within a single account.
A2E's Image-to-Video tool uses AI to turn any image into a short, dynamic video with facial movement and expression. No video editing required. Upload a still photo, describe the motion you want, and the platform renders a 5-15 second MP4 video. Most clips are 5-10 seconds long, with select models supporting durations up to 15-20 seconds.
The core value proposition: instead of buying three separate subscriptions (Kling, Seedance, Veo), you get all of them in one account for $0 on the free tier. This approach works if you spend time comparing model outputs and need flexibility. It's a disadvantage if you want a single "best choice" without cognitive load.
How A2E AI Works: The Image-to-Video Process
The workflow is straightforward and designed to work even for non-technical users.
Step 1: Upload Your Image
Start with any static image—a portrait, product shot, illustration, or screenshot. Avoid blurry, dark, or extremely low-resolution photos for optimal output. A2E doesn't care about file size; both PNG and JPG formats work. The image becomes your reference frame—all motion generated by the AI respects the composition, colors, and subject positioning from your original.
Step 2: Write a Motion Prompt
Describe what should happen in the video. Examples include: Camera slowly zooms in while the character's eyes blink naturally; Steam drifts upward from a hot coffee cup, gentle parallax movement; The person looks to the left, smiles, nods twice; Product spins 360 degrees on a white background, soft lighting.
A2E accepts detailed prompts describing motion, camera angles, lighting, and atmosphere. Unlike some competitors that truncate long prompts, A2E handles comprehensive descriptions fully.
Step 3: Select Your AI Model
Choose from 13+ models hosted on the platform including Kling 3.0/2.6 (excellent at realistic human motion), Seedance 2.0/1.5 (preserves text and logos), Wan 2.7/2.6 (smooth motion), Veo 3.1 (complex scenes), Sora 2 Pro (top-tier quality), and HappyHorse 1.0 (stylized motion).
Testing across 20+ clips showed different models excel at different scenarios. Kling dominates portrait animations. Seedance preserves product details better than others. Veo handles complex backgrounds more reliably.

Real Performance: A2E AI vs. Competitors
Testing revealed what marketers don't mention: every tool has failure modes. Testing was conducted across A2E, Seedance, Kling (direct), Pika, Runway, and competitors with 200+ generations including portraits, product shots, and illustrations.
Where A2E Excels
Multi-model comparison without wallet pain is A2E's strongest advantage. You can generate on multiple models and immediately see which handles your scenario best, without buying separate subscriptions. Additionally, A2E offers watermark-free free tier output, which is genuinely uncommon among competitors. Ambient and atmospheric motion rendering works reliably on A2E, and there is zero signup friction compared to competitors.
Where A2E Struggles
Short clip ceiling limits outputs to 5-20 seconds, which works for TikTok but not longer narratives. Credit waste on failed outputs is common, with re-roll rates averaging 2.1-2.8 attempts per usable clip. Pricing has been volatile historically, affecting user trust. Model orchestration overhead creates decision paralysis when choosing between 13 options.
Top A2E AI Alternatives
Veo 3.1 (Google's AI Video)
Veo 3.1 leads for cinematic prompt-following. It excels at complex scenes with multiple subjects and realistic environmental details. Higher cost per generation but available through QuestStudio and LTX Studio.
Kling 3.0 (Best for Motion Quality)
Kling focuses on motion quality with emphasis on smooth, dynamic motion that feels natural in longer sequences. Up to 3-minute clips, native audio, best for portraits and character animation. If you only generate image-to-video and want longest possible output, Kling is the single-tool winner.
Pika (Fastest for Quick Tests)
Pika is a strong alternative if you want fast idea-to-video generation and short-form content workflows. Fast generations with minimal interface, strong for social content. Downside is higher re-roll rate means effective cost is 2.5-3x higher than upfront pricing.
Runway Gen-4.5 (Best for Editing)
Runway is the strongest all-rounder with reference image support, camera control, and consistent character handling. Built-in video editor, motion controls, extend/regenerate features. Premium choice for professionals.
Morphed (Best Multi-Model Desktop)
Morphed is the strongest alternative with 15+ AI models for both image and video generation. If your workflow includes photo generation before video generation, Morphed bundles both capabilities.
